Zoey was super high and measuring pretty big (bigger than even my normal big measurement) today. Because of this and the fact he couldn't verify her position I have to get an ultrasound to check her size and position before next weeks appointment.
Lastly, I am GBS positive. This bummed me out a bit since I didn't have it with Brodie but it made me feel better to know i didn't do anything to get it. It's naturally occurring and to ensure Zoey doesn't get it during birth I have to get 2 rounds of antibiotics during labor, given 4 hours apart via an IV. I can still get it through my hep lock and after its administered I can walk around and not be confined to a bed. The biggest bummer is that I can't labor at home as long as I was planning because I have to make sure I get both doses and if my water breaks I need to go in within an hour since baby is exposed to infection at that point.
